A Lifetime of Devotion

October 26, 2025 Betsy Gómez

In Christ Jesus, you who were far away have been brought near by the blood of Christ. —Ephesians 2:13

In light of Christ’s liberating work on our behalf, devotion to Him isn’t something to be confined to a half-hour task—it’s meant to last a lifetime. There’s no way to do “your devotions” and mark it off a to-do list, because our devotion to Christ should never end.

His praise should always be on our lips. As we go about our day—walking, working, and even sitting in silence—we can bring our requests to Him. We run to His Word not because it’s a duty but because it’s there that we find life.

Should we have discipline in our daily devotions? Of course! But we should view it not as a task we do to be right with God but as an opportunity to enjoy Him. And when we feel discouraged or frustrated with ourselves for falling short, let us return to the cross and find at His feet a thousand more reasons to continue giving all our devotion to the only One who deserves it: Christ.
